Climate and Seasonal Considerations

When it comes to planting strawberries, one of the most important factors to consider is the climate and the right season for planting. Strawberries thrive in cool weather, with temperatures ranging from 60 to 80 degrees Fahrenheit (15 to 27 degrees Celsius). They require a minimum of six hours of sunlight per day to produce sweet and juicy fruits.

Generally, the best time to plant strawberries is in early spring or fall, depending on your specific climate. If you live in a region with mild winters and long growing seasons, such as Southern California or Florida, you can plant strawberries in the fall for a late winter or early spring harvest. On the other hand, if you reside in a colder climate with harsh winters, it’s advisable to wait until spring to avoid potential frost damage.

Before you start planting, it’s crucial to assess your local climate and determine the average first and last frost dates. This information will help you choose the most suitable planting time. Additionally, consider the length of your growing season, as strawberries typically take about four to six weeks to establish themselves before frost or extreme heat sets in.

Another important consideration is the USDA Hardiness Zone for your area. Strawberries thrive in zones 3 to 10, with some varieties being more cold-tolerant than others. If you’re unsure about your zone, consult the USDA’s Plant Hardiness Zone Map or consult with local experts at a gardening center.

Lastly, keep in mind that strawberries are highly susceptible to high heat and intense sunlight. If you live in an area with scorching summers, consider planting your strawberries in a spot with afternoon shade or providing them with shade cloth to protect them from excessive sun exposure.

Choosing the Right Variety

When it comes to selecting the right variety of strawberries for your garden, there are several factors to consider. Different varieties offer varying flavors, sizes, and growth habits, so it’s important to choose the one that best suits your preferences and growing conditions.

One of the key factors to keep in mind is the type of strawberry variety: June-bearing, day-neutral, or everbearing. June-bearing varieties produce a single large crop of strawberries in late spring or early summer. These varieties are ideal for those who want a bountiful harvest all at once, perfect for making preserves or enjoying fresh strawberries during the summer months. Day-neutral varieties produce strawberries consistently throughout the growing season, regardless of day length. They are a great choice for those who want a steady supply of strawberries all summer long. Finally, everbearing varieties produce two to three smaller crops of strawberries, with the first crop typically appearing in late spring or early summer.

In addition to considering the growth habit, you should also think about the flavor profile you prefer. Some varieties offer sweet and aromatic berries, while others have a more acidic or tangy taste. It’s a good idea to taste different varieties before making a final decision.

Furthermore, consider the size of the strawberries. Some varieties produce large, juicy berries that are perfect for eating fresh or using in desserts, while others have smaller berries that are great for jams and sauces.

It’s also essential to choose varieties that are well-suited to your specific climate and growing conditions. Some varieties thrive in colder regions, while others are more heat-tolerant. Take into account your average temperatures, soil conditions, and the length of your growing season when selecting the right variety for your garden.

Lastly, consider disease resistance. Some strawberry varieties are more resistant to common diseases, such as powdery mildew and verticillium wilt. Choosing disease-resistant varieties can help ensure that your plants stay healthy and productive.

With the wide range of strawberry varieties available, it’s important to do some research and perhaps seek advice from local experts. By choosing the right variety, you can enjoy a successful strawberry harvest and savor the delightful flavors of fresh, homegrown strawberries.

Preparing the Soil

Proper soil preparation is crucial for growing healthy and productive strawberry plants. Before planting, it’s important to ensure that the soil is well-draining, rich in organic matter, and has a pH level between 5.5 and 6.5.

The first step in preparing the soil is to remove any weeds, rocks, or debris that may hinder the growth of your strawberry plants. This can be done by hand or using gardening tools such as a garden hoe or rake.

Next, you should loosen the soil to a depth of around 12 inches (30 cm) using a garden fork or tiller. This will help improve drainage and create a loose, friable soil texture that allows the strawberry roots to spread easily.

If your soil is heavy clay or sandy, incorporating organic matter is essential. Adding compost, well-rotted manure, or aged leaf mulch to the soil will help improve its structure, nutrient content, and water-holding capacity. Aim to mix in about 2 to 3 inches (5 to 7.5 cm) of organic matter into the top layer of soil.

After incorporating organic matter, it’s advisable to perform a soil test to determine the pH level of your soil. Strawberries prefer slightly acidic soil, so if the pH level is too high, you can lower it by adding elemental sulfur or acidifying fertilizers to the soil based on the recommendations of the soil test results.

Once the soil is properly prepared, it’s a good idea to wait a week or two before planting to allow the organic matter to decompose and the soil to settle.

It’s worth noting that if you’re planting strawberries in a raised bed or containers, you have more control over the soil conditions. In these cases, you can use a high-quality potting mix specifically formulated for strawberries or create a custom mix using a combination of compost, peat moss, vermiculite, and perlite.

By taking the time to prepare the soil properly, you’ll create an optimal growing environment for your strawberry plants, ensuring healthier plants and a more abundant harvest.

Planting in the Spring

Spring is an ideal time to plant strawberries, as the weather starts to warm up and the risk of frost diminishes. Here is a step-by-step guide on how to plant strawberries in the spring:

  1. Choose healthy plants: Start by selecting young, healthy strawberry plants from a reputable nursery or garden center. Look for plants with green leaves and no signs of disease or pests.
  2. Prepare the soil: As mentioned earlier, ensure that the soil is well-draining, rich in organic matter, and has a slightly acidic pH. Remove any weeds or debris and loosen the soil to a depth of 12 inches (30 cm).
  3. Spacing: Dig holes or make furrows in the soil, leaving about 12 to 18 inches (30 to 45 cm) between each plant. Rows should be spaced at least 2 to 3 feet (60 to 90 cm) apart.
  4. Planting depth: Place each strawberry plant in the hole or furrow, ensuring that the crown is level with the soil surface. Avoid burying the crown too deep, as this can lead to rotting. For bare-root plants, spread the roots evenly in the hole before covering them with soil.
  5. Pack the soil: Gently firm the soil around the plants to provide support and establish good root-to-soil contact. Avoid compacting the soil too tightly, as this can hinder water and nutrient absorption.
  6. Watering: After planting, give the strawberry plants a thorough watering to settle the soil and promote root establishment. Provide regular watering throughout the growing season, aiming for about 1 inch (2.5 cm) of water per week.
  7. Mulching: Apply a layer of organic mulch, such as straw or pine needles, around the plants to help conserve moisture, suppress weeds, and protect the berries from coming into direct contact with the soil.
  8. Fertilizing: About four weeks after planting, apply a balanced fertilizer specifically formulated for strawberries. Follow the package instructions for application rates and frequency.

Remember to monitor the plants closely for any signs of pests or diseases and take appropriate action to prevent and manage them. Regularly inspect the plants for weeds, removing them as necessary to prevent competition for nutrients and water.

By following these steps and providing proper care, you can enjoy a bountiful harvest of delicious strawberries in the late spring or early summer.

Planting in the Fall

Planting strawberries in the fall can be a great option for gardeners in regions with mild winters and longer growing seasons. It allows the plants to establish themselves during the cooler months and provides an early harvest the following year. Here’s a step-by-step guide on how to plant strawberries in the fall:

  1. Selection of varieties: Choose strawberry varieties that are well-suited for fall planting. Look for varieties that have a shorter time to maturity, allowing them to produce abundant fruits before the arrival of winter.
  2. Timing: Plant strawberries in late summer or early fall, typically around 4 to 6 weeks before the first expected frost date. This timing allows the plants to establish their root systems before winter sets in.
  3. Soil preparation: Prepare the soil by removing any weeds, rocks, or debris. Ensure that the soil is well-draining, fertile, and has a pH level between 5.5 and 6.5. Amend the soil with organic matter like compost or well-rotted manure to improve its structure and nutrient content.
  4. Planting location: Choose a sunny location for your strawberry plants that receives at least 6 hours of direct sunlight each day. Avoid areas prone to standing water or excessive moisture, as this can lead to root rot.
  5. Spacing: Dig holes or make furrows in the soil with a spacing of about 12 to 18 inches (30 to 45 cm) between each plant. Rows should be spaced at least 2 to 3 feet (60 to 90 cm) apart.
  6. Planting depth: Position each strawberry plant in the hole or furrow, ensuring that the crown is level with the soil surface. Avoid burying the crown too deep, as this can lead to crown rot. For bare-root plants, spread out the roots evenly in the hole before covering them with soil.
  7. Packing and watering: Gently firm the soil around the plants to provide support and establish good root-to-soil contact. Give the newly planted strawberries a thorough watering to settle the soil and promote root establishment.
  8. Mulching: Apply a layer of organic mulch, such as straw or pine needles, around the plants to help conserve moisture, regulate soil temperature, and suppress weed growth.
  9. Winter protection: In regions with colder winters, consider using row covers or straw to provide additional protection against frost and freezing temperatures. This will help insulate the plants and prevent damage to the crowns.

After planting, continue to water the plants regularly, ensuring that the soil remains consistently moist. Monitor the plants for pests and diseases, and take appropriate measures to control them.

By planting strawberries in the fall and providing proper care, you can enjoy a delicious harvest of strawberries in the following spring and early summer.

Proper Planting Depth

Planting strawberries at the proper depth is essential for their successful growth and development. Planting too shallow or too deep can result in poor establishment, weak root growth, and reduced fruit production. Here are some guidelines for ensuring the proper planting depth for your strawberry plants:

The crown of the strawberry plant, where the stems emerge from the roots, plays a crucial role in its growth and survival. Planting the crown at the correct depth is essential. Too shallow planting can expose the crown, making it vulnerable to drying out or rotting. On the other hand, planting too deep can cause the crown to suffocate or experience excessive moisture, leading to rot.

When planting bare-root strawberry plants, ensure that the crown is level with the soil surface. Spread the roots evenly in the planting hole, gently covering them with soil, and then firming the soil around the plant. The crown should be visible but not exposed above the soil line. This level planting ensures proper air circulation and prevents crown rot.

For pot-grown strawberry plants, check the soil level in the container and make sure to plant at the same depth when transferring them. If any roots are circling the bottom of the container, gently untangle them before planting to encourage proper root growth.

It’s important to note that if the crown is planted too deep, the strawberry plant may develop a weak and elongated stem as it tries to reach for sunlight. This can impact the overall health and productivity of the plant.

As a general guideline, the planting depth for strawberries should be such that the soil is in contact with the roots while the crown is slightly elevated above the soil surface. By maintaining this balance, the plant has access to both air and moisture, promoting healthy growth and fruit production.

During the planting process, take care not to compact the soil too tightly around the crown, as this can hinder water absorption and restrict root growth. After planting, water the newly planted strawberries thoroughly to settle the soil and provide adequate moisture for root establishment.

Overall, ensuring the proper planting depth when setting out your strawberry plants will contribute to their long-term health and productivity, allowing you to enjoy a bountiful harvest of flavorful strawberries.

Spacing and Layout

Proper spacing and layout are essential considerations when planting strawberries. Adequate spacing allows the plants to receive sufficient sunlight, airflow, and nutrients, ensuring healthy growth and maximum fruit production. Here are some guidelines for spacing and layout when planting strawberries:

Spacing between strawberry plants: Strawberries should be spaced about 12 to 18 inches (30 to 45 cm) apart within a row. This spacing provides enough room for the plants to spread and grow, without overcrowding. If the plants are too close together, they can compete for resources and increase the risk of diseases and pests. Leave enough space for air circulation to reduce humidity and prevent the spread of fungal infections.

Spacing between rows: Rows of strawberries should be spaced approximately 2 to 3 feet (60 to 90 cm) apart. This spacing allows for easy access between rows for maintenance tasks such as watering, weed removal, and harvesting. It also ensures that the plants have ample space to grow and receive adequate sunlight.

Planting in mounds or raised beds: Another popular method for planting strawberries is in mounds or raised beds. Mounding the soil or using raised beds helps improve drainage and prevents waterlogging, which is beneficial for strawberry plants. Space the plants within the mounds or raised beds using the same guidelines of 12 to 18 inches (30 to 45 cm) between plants.

Layout considerations: Consider the overall layout when planting strawberries in larger areas. If planting multiple rows, leave wider paths between rows to provide easy access. Strategically plan the layout to optimize sunlight exposure, especially in areas with limited direct sunlight. If planning to use drip irrigation or row covers, ensure that you have enough space to accommodate the necessary equipment.

For container gardening: If growing strawberries in containers, choose a container that is large enough to accommodate the roots and allows for proper drainage. Space the plants according to the same guidelines of 12 to 18 inches (30 to 45 cm) between plants within the container. Make sure the container receives adequate sunlight throughout the day and rotate it occasionally to ensure even growth.

By following proper spacing and layout guidelines, you can ensure that your strawberry plants have enough room to grow, access ample sunlight, and receive necessary care. Adequate spacing promotes healthy development, reduces the risk of diseases, and maximizes fruit production, resulting in a successful and bountiful strawberry harvest.

Watering and Fertilizing

Proper watering and fertilizing practices are crucial for the health and productivity of strawberry plants. By providing them with adequate water and necessary nutrients, you can ensure their vigorous growth and a plentiful harvest. Here’s a guide to watering and fertilizing your strawberry plants:

Watering:

Strawberries have shallow roots, so consistent and thorough watering is essential, especially during periods of dry weather. Aim for about 1 inch (2.5 cm) of water per week, either from rainfall or irrigation. Water deeply, ensuring that the soil is evenly moist but not waterlogged.

It’s important to strike a balance with watering. Avoid allowing the soil to dry out completely, as this can stress the plants and lead to reduced fruit production. However, overly saturated soil can cause root rot and other diseases. Regularly check the moisture level by inserting your finger into the soil, and adjust your watering routine accordingly.

Consider using a drip irrigation system or soaker hose to water strawberries. These methods deliver water directly to the soil, minimizing evaporation and reducing the risk of fungal diseases. Avoid overhead sprinklers, as wet foliage can promote disease development.

During the fruiting period, it’s essential to ensure a consistent water supply. Inadequate water during this time can result in small and misshapen berries. Mulching around the plants can help retain moisture, reduce weed growth, and regulate soil temperature.

Fertilizing:

Strawberries are heavy feeders and require regular fertilization to sustain their growth and fruit production. Start by preparing the soil with organic matter, such as compost, well-rotted manure, or a balanced slow-release fertilizer, before planting.

Once the plants are established, they benefit from supplemental fertilization throughout the growing season. Apply a balanced granular fertilizer, formulated specifically for strawberries or general-purpose fruit fertilizers, according to the package instructions.

For traditional June-bearing varieties, apply the first round of fertilizer when flowering begins and repeat every four to six weeks until the end of harvest. For everbearing and day-neutral varieties, apply fertilizer monthly during the growing season.

Avoid over-fertilizing, as excessive nutrients can lead to excessive foliage growth with diminished fruit production. Always follow the recommended application rates and avoid directly applying fertilizer to the crowns of the plants to prevent burn or damage.

It’s beneficial to include a balanced mix of nutrients, including nitrogen, phosphorus, and potassium, in the fertilizer. These essential nutrients support overall plant development, root growth, flowering, and fruit formation.

Regularly monitor the plants for any signs of nutrient deficiency, such as yellowing leaves or stunted growth. Adjust your fertilization schedule or seek advice from a local gardening expert if necessary.

By properly watering and fertilizing your strawberry plants, you can provide them with the necessary resources for healthy growth, robust fruit production, and a rewarding harvest of delicious strawberries.

Mulching to Protect the Plants

Mulching is an important practice when growing strawberries as it provides numerous benefits, including weed suppression, moisture retention, and temperature regulation. By applying a layer of organic mulch, you can protect your strawberry plants and promote their overall health and productivity. Here’s what you need to know about mulching strawberries:

Benefits of Mulching:

1. Weed suppression: One of the primary benefits of mulching is its ability to suppress weed growth around strawberry plants. By creating a barrier between the soil and the surrounding environment, mulch prevents weed seeds from germinating and competing with the strawberries for nutrients, water, and sunlight. This not only reduces the amount of manual weeding required but also minimizes the risk of weed-related diseases.

2. Moisture retention: Mulch helps regulate soil moisture levels by reducing evaporation and preventing water runoff. It acts as a protective layer, preventing excess water from evaporating during hot summer days while allowing rain or irrigation water to penetrate the soil. This maintains consistent soil moisture, which is crucial for strawberry plants, as they have shallow root systems and require consistent hydration to flourish.

3. Temperature regulation: Strawberries are sensitive to temperature fluctuations, especially during winter and early spring. Mulch acts as an insulating layer, protecting the plants’ roots and crowns from extreme temperatures. In the colder months, it helps retain soil warmth and prevents freezing, while in the hotter months, it shields the roots from excessive heat, maintaining a more moderate soil temperature.

Choosing the Right Mulch:

1. Straw: Straw is often the go-to choice for mulching strawberries. It is lightweight, allows for adequate airflow, and facilitates water penetration. Place a layer of straw approximately 2 to 4 inches (5 to 10 cm) thick around the plants, avoiding direct contact with the leaves or crowns to prevent rot or disease. Wheat straw and pine straw are commonly used options.

2. Wood chips or shredded leaves: Wood chips or shredded leaves can also be used as mulch for strawberries. They provide effective weed suppression and moisture retention. However, it’s important to ensure they are aged or composted to avoid nitrogen depletion in the soil as they break down.

3. Plastic or landscape fabric: Plastic or landscape fabric can be used as mulch for strawberries, particularly in areas with heavy weed pressure. These materials create an impenetrable barrier to weed growth and can be especially effective for weed control. However, they do not provide organic matter to the soil or allow for air and water exchange, so it’s important to monitor soil moisture levels and provide adequate irrigation.

Application and Maintenance:

Apply the mulch once the soil has warmed up in the spring, and after the plants have started growing. Place the mulch around the plants in a layer, making sure to leave a small gap between the mulch and the plant stems to prevent rotting.

Regularly check the mulch layer throughout the growing season to ensure it remains intact and is not compacted. If needed, add more mulch to maintain the desired depth and thickness. Mulch should be replaced annually to maintain its effectiveness and prevent the buildup of pests or diseases.

Mulching is a simple yet powerful technique that offers numerous benefits for strawberry plants. By providing weed suppression, moisture retention, and temperature regulation, mulch can create an ideal environment for healthy and productive strawberries.

Protecting from Frost and Cold Temperatures

Frost and cold temperatures can pose a significant threat to strawberry plants. Low temperatures can damage or kill the delicate flowers and young fruit, resulting in a reduced harvest. However, with proper protection measures, you can safeguard your strawberry plants from frost and cold temperatures. Here are some strategies to consider:

1. Covering with row covers or cloths: One of the most effective methods to protect strawberry plants from frost is by covering them with row covers or cloths. These lightweight fabrics provide insulation, trapping heat emitted from the soil and preventing cold air from directly contacting the plants. Secure the covers over the plants, ensuring they are anchored to the ground to avoid wind displacement. Remove the covers during the day to allow sunlight and airflow.

2. Using frost blankets: Frost blankets, also known as floating row covers, can provide significant protection against frost damage. These lightweight, breathable fabrics are designed to be placed directly on the plants, creating a barrier to keep cold air at bay. Frost blankets can be left in place for extended periods, allowing sunlight, air, and water to reach the plants.

3. Utilizing individual plant covers: In smaller gardens or for individual plants, consider using protective covers designed specifically for strawberries. These covers are placed over individual plants, providing insulation and shielding them from frost and cold temperatures. They are convenient and often offer a more targeted level of protection.

4. Mulching and soil insulation: A layer of mulch around the base of strawberry plants can act as insulation, protecting the roots from extreme temperatures. Apply mulch in the fall, after the ground has cooled down, to help regulate soil temperature and prevent sudden temperature fluctuations. Mulch also helps keep soil moisture consistent, minimizing stress on the plants.

5. Irrigation and water management: Proper watering practices can contribute to frost protection. Wet soil retains more heat than dry soil, so it’s advisable to water the strawberry plants before an anticipated frost event. Wet soil absorbs and releases heat slowly, which can help raise the temperature around the plants and mitigate potential frost damage.

6. Site selection: When initially planting strawberries, choose a site that is less prone to frost. Avoid low-lying areas or areas near frost pockets, as cold air tends to settle in these locations. Plant strawberries on elevated beds or slopes if possible.

7. Monitoring weather conditions: Stay informed about local weather forecasts, specifically monitoring for frost warnings. This will allow you to take preventive measures in a timely manner and protect your strawberry plants from potential cold-related damage.

Remember, even with protective measures, prolonged exposure to extreme cold temperatures can still cause damage to strawberry plants. However, these techniques can significantly enhance the plants’ chances of survival and minimize the impact of frost events. By being proactive and implementing protective strategies, you can safeguard your strawberry plants and maximize their potential for a fruitful harvest.

Maintaining and Pruning the Plants

Maintaining and pruning your strawberry plants is crucial for their overall health, productivity, and longevity. Regular care and proper pruning techniques help create optimal growing conditions, promote better airflow, control pests and diseases, and ensure a bountiful harvest. Here are some important tips for maintaining and pruning strawberry plants:

1. Regular inspection and maintenance:

  • Inspect your plants regularly for signs of pests, diseases, or nutrient deficiencies. Catching any issues early allows for prompt intervention and helps prevent the spread of problems.
  • Remove any yellowing or diseased leaves, as they can be a source of infection for the rest of the plant. Dispose of them away from the garden to prevent contamination.
  • Weed regularly around the plants to reduce competition for nutrients and water. Be cautious while weeding to avoid damaging the shallow roots of the strawberry plants.
  • Keep the area around the plants clean and free of debris to discourage pests and provide a healthier growing environment.

2. Pruning runners:

  • Runners are long stems that emerge from the mother plant and produce new plants, which can overcrowd the strawberry bed if left unchecked.
  • To maintain plant vigor and prevent overcrowding, selectively prune the runners by snipping them close to the mother plant or transplanting them to new locations if desired.
  • Regularly removing the runners encourages the plants to put their energy into fruit production rather than vegetative growth.

3. Trimming and thinning:

  • Trim the older, unproductive foliage from your strawberry plants in late winter or early spring before new growth begins. This enables the plants to focus their energy on producing healthy leaves and flowers.
  • Thin out overly dense areas by removing weaker or overcrowded plants. This ensures better airflow, reducing the risk of fungal diseases and creating space for healthy plant development.

4. Fertilizing and soil management:

  • Apply balanced fertilizer or compost in early spring and late summer to provide the plants with essential nutrients. Follow the recommended application rates on the product label.
  • Monitor soil moisture levels, especially during dry periods. Adequate watering and mulching help maintain consistent soil moisture, promoting healthy growth and fruit production.
  • Consider performing soil tests periodically to assess nutrient levels and pH. Adjust soil conditions accordingly to ensure optimal plant health.

5. Disease and pest control:

  • Inspect your plants regularly for signs of pests, such as aphids, mites, or slugs. Employ natural pest control methods like handpicking or using organic insecticides if needed.
  • Implement proper sanitation practices, such as cleaning tools and beds, to reduce the risk of fungal diseases such as gray mold or powdery mildew.
  • Monitor for common strawberry diseases like leaf spot or root rot. If detected, promptly remove affected plant parts and consider using disease-resistant varieties in the future.

By consistently maintaining and pruning your strawberry plants, you can promote their long-term health and productivity. Regular inspection, pruning, and proper care ensure that the plants are free from pests and diseases, given adequate nutrients, and well-managed for optimal growth and abundant strawberry harvests.

Harvesting Strawberries

Harvesting strawberries at the peak of ripeness ensures the best flavor, texture, and overall quality of the fruit. Timing and proper handling are essential to maximize your enjoyment of these delicious berries. Here are some guidelines for harvesting strawberries:

1. Determining ripeness:

  • Observe the color of the berries. Strawberries should have a vibrant, deep red hue when fully ripe.
  • Gently squeeze the berries. Ripe strawberries will be firm but slightly soft to the touch. Avoid berries that are overly soft or mushy, as they may be overripe or spoiled.
  • Check for a sweet fragrance. Ripe strawberries often emit a sweet and pleasant aroma.

2. Harvesting techniques:

  • Use clean, sharp scissors or garden shears to cut the stem about a quarter inch above the berry. Avoid pulling or twisting the berries, as this can damage the plant and nearby fruit.
  • Hold the berry gently to avoid bruising, and make sure to remove the entire stem, leaving no portion attached to the fruit.
  • Place harvested strawberries in a shallow container to prevent them from being crushed under their weight. Avoid overcrowding the container to maintain the integrity of the berries.

3. Harvesting frequency:

  • Strawberries should be harvested as soon as they are fully ripe to ensure the best taste and quality.
  • Check your plants every couple of days during the peak season, as strawberries can ripen quickly, especially in warm weather.
  • Harvest in the morning when the berries are cool and the sugar content is highest. This will maximize the sweetness and flavor of the fruit.

4. Post-harvest care:

  • Once harvested, store the strawberries in the refrigerator immediately. Keeping them at temperatures between 32°F and 35°F (0°C and 2°C) helps preserve their freshness and flavor.
  • Do not wash the berries until you’re ready to consume or use them, as excess moisture can lead to spoilage. Remove any damaged or moldy berries before storage.
  • For long-term storage, consider freezing or preserving strawberries through methods like canning or making jams and jellies.

Remember, strawberries taste best when eaten at their peak ripeness and freshness. Harvesting them when fully ripe ensures that you experience the full sweetness and juiciness of these delightful fruits.
